Guest EternallyLazy Posted September 15, 2003 Report Posted September 15, 2003 As of post-show tonight, the preliminary belief is that Brock Lesnar may have floating cartilage in his knee, which caused the knee to lock toward the end of the match with Kurt Angle earlier tonight in Richmond, VA. At this point they are going with the idea that Tuesday's Iron Man match is not in jeopardy observer.com

Has there ever been a high profile feud that just seems cursed such as this one? I can't ever remember a feud where something was wrong going into every match.
Guest NCJ Posted September 16, 2003 Report Posted September 16, 2003 Any time in ECW when RVD was suppossed to go over for the World title. RVD vs Taz: Company was totally building towards Taz vs RVD everyone knew it was coming. Then Taz signed with WWF, and the blowoff match was just thrown together. RVD vs Mike Awesome: Less than a month after RVD begins the program he blows out his knee on a damn baseball slide. Right before RVD gets clearance to compete Awesome leaves the company. RVD vs. Rhyno: Everyone knew it was going to be the fued if their was any way for ECW to stay afloat then the company shut down.
